DrummaBoy: Like my brother and friend Candour, I am loosing the steam to debate tithe on this forum but I just cannot but respond to this post. It would be good that tithe advocate check up the meaning of the word Principle in the dictionary and when they are through with that they should show us were, and anywhere, the Bible stated categorically that tithe is a principle.

From the scriptures FOLYKAZE quoted it is clear as noon day the purpose of the tithe: to provide for a group of people God had selected from Israel of old to administer the religious and civil life of His people. These people, the levites, were not to inherit the land and God, who is ever fair and ballanced, said that though you will not have land, you will have the tithe. The tithe was meant to be a means of sustenance for this people who had nothing. So what is the principle behind tithing: it is not the tithe itself but the fact that God is fair and would have everyone provided for. The levites had nothing and so should have the tithe. The principle it further depicts therefore is that God's work should be provided for.

In today's church, were many are demanding tithes, we see minister owning lands, cars and jets, and still demanding the tithe. The principle of provision in the house of God is sufficiently covered by the call on believers to give willingly and without compulsion. Anything beyond this it is legalistic and a fraud.

The height of the NT Christian life is the fact that believers can be led by the Spirit and not by written codes. If the written code demanded tithing in the OT, it makes sense to see that that has been translated to a life of the Spirit, being led by the Spirit, in free will giving. The moment it becomes a compulsory 10%, it is no longer a leading; there is no more a freedom to give; it becomes legalistic.

The worst part of this tithe fraud is how modern day ministers are feasting fat on it, while poor Christians have to tithe their meager allowances.
